Abstract

This study aims to analyse the application of the Project Based Learning (PjBL) model in improving the creativity of grade V students in science subjects with the topic of electrical energy at the Cendekia Integrated Islamic Elementary School (SDIT). This research uses the Classroom Action Research (PTK) method which is carried out in two cycles. Each cycle consists of planning, implementation, observation, and reflection stages. The research subjects were fifth grade students of SDIT Cendekia, with a total of 25 students. The research instruments included observation sheets, creativity questionnaires, and documentation. The results showed that the application of the PjBL model could improve students' creativity. In cycle I, the average percentage of student creativity reached 75% (moderately creative category), while in cycle II it increased to 85% (very creative category). Thus, Project Based Learning is effective in increasing the creativity of grade V students in science subjects. It is recommended for teachers to implement this model sustainably in learning science and other subjects.
